How does a directional control valve work?

How does a directional valve work? A directional control valve typically consists of a sliding spool inside a cylinder that features lands and grooves. It is usually mechanically or electrically actuated, and the position of the spool restricts or permits flow, controlling the fluid path .

How do you tell if a hydraulic valve is open or closed center?

So in a nutshell, open-center systems always have oil flow . Closed-center systems are always under pressure but oil does not flow until you activate a lever asking the system to perform.

What is the N port on a hydraulic valve?

N is neutral . P is pump or pressure. T is tank.

How are direction control valves classified?

Directional control valves are classified according to certain factors like inlet control element structure, number of ports or ways, number of position, method of actuation, and center position flow pattern . In a directional control valve, the internal control element would be a sliding spool, rotary spool or ball.

What does C mean in hydraulics?

Closed Center System – A hydraulic system in which the control valves are closed during neutral, stopping oil flow. Flow in this system is varied, but pressure remains constant.

How does a closed loop hydraulic system work?

Thus, a closed loop (hydrostatic) system offers a way to finely control the speed and direction of a motor . Unlike an open loop hydraulic system, fluid does not flow to a reservoir, but flows directly back to the pump (which is why the term “closed loop” is used to describe this type of circuit).

What is the main purpose of a directional control valve 3 2?

A 3/2-way valve has three ports and two positions that can be driven pneumatically, mechanically, manually or electrically via a solenoid valve. They are used, for example, to control a single-action cylinder, driving pneumatic actuators, blow-off, pressure release and vacuum applications .

What is the function of sequence valve used in hydraulic circuits?

A sequence valve is a pressure valve designed to open when its set pressure is reached, providing a path of flow alternate and sequential to the primary circuit . In some ways, a sequence valve is a directional valve, allowing flow to occur.

What will happen if there is air trapped in the hydraulic system?

Air in the hydraulic fluid makes an alarming banging or knocking noise when it compresses and decompresses , as it circulates through the system. Other symptoms include foaming of the fluid and erratic actuator movement.

What are the most common causes of hydraulic system failure?

Air and water contamination are the leading causes of hydraulic failure, accounting for 80 to 90% of hydraulic failures. Faulty pumps, system breaches or temperature issues often cause both types of contamination.

What is the difference between open loop and closed loop hydraulic system?

For open loop system, a directional control valve is used for setting the direction of movement of the actuator. In closed loop system, one additional pump, called charge pump or a feed pump (a constant displacement pump) is used for making up the circuit fluid.

How do you remove air from a hydraulic system?

Bleeding only works for “free” air pockets where the air has not mixed with the fluid. For dissolved air, you can remove it by raising the temperature of the fluid until the air is released. This should only be done if absolutely necessary as hydraulic oil will normally tend to be at least 10% dissolved air.

How does open hydraulic system work?

In an open system, the pump is always working, moving oil through the pipes without building up pressure . Both the inlet to the pump and the return valve are hooked up to a hydraulic reservoir. These are also called “open center” systems, because of the open central path of the control valve when it is neutral.

How does a diaphragm valve work?

Diaphragm valves use a flexible diaphragm connected to a compressor by a stud which is molded into the diaphragm . Instead of pinching the liner closed to provide shut-off, the diaphragm is pushed into contact with the bottom of the valve body to provide shut-off.

What is bonnet in control valve?

A valve bonnet covers the opening through which the internal parts are inserted. The bonnet serves as the mounting base for the actuator . It includes the seal which prevents fluid leakage along the stem.

What is bonnet in valve?

Bonnet. A bonnet acts as a cover on the valve body . It is commonly semi-permanently screwed into the valve body or bolted onto it. During manufacture of the valve, the internal parts are put into the body and then the bonnet is attached to hold everything together inside.

How does a hydraulic valve bank work?

A hydraulic solenoid valve is a solenoid controlled directional valve used in a hydraulic system for opening, closing or changing the direction of flow of the liquid . The valve operates with a solenoid, which is an electric coil wound around a ferromagnetic core at its center.

What is the difference between an open center selector valve and a closed center selector valve?

An open center valve allows a continuous flow of system hydraulic fluid through the valve even when the selector is not in a position to actuate a unit. A closed-center selector valve blocks the flow of fluid through the valve when it is in the NEUTRAL or OFF position.
